Chain Extension of Polyamide 6 with 2,2'-(1,3-phenylene)bis(2-oxazoline)

Abstract: Chain-extension of polyamide6 (PA6) was carried out by reacting with 2,2'-(1,3-phenylene)bis(2-oxazoline) (MPBO) in melt. The optical chain-extension was found when the loading of MPBO was 2.0 % at 240 ℃. After chain-extension, the number-average molecular weight of PA6 increased from 1.4×104 to 2.5×104, the tensile strength, elongation at break, and intrinsic viscosity increased, the melt flow index dropped. However, crystallinity and crystallization temperature were decreased.
